The most prized and expensive wine in the world is produced in the Grand East Region of France (formerly Champagne-Ardenne) and is classified as a “Grand Cru” for the excellent quality of the grapes used. The Grand Cru grape is grown in the 8 hectares of vineyards of the family-run Champagne Chapuy di Oger winery. The result is extraordinary: Champagne is fresh on the palate with penetrating floral notes on the finish for a velvety and silky texture. Drinking it, you can enjoy a blend with an elegant aroma and a really intense taste.

The bottle of this elite wine can be considered as a real work of art, it is no coincidence that the limited edition was made by the famous designer Alexander Amosu (famous for his exclusive luxury creations) at the request of a very important customer. The unique piece is adorned with a beautiful Swarovski crystal positioned in the centre of a diamond-shaped design reminiscent of the Superman logo. The materials used to raise the prestige of this good to the square: 48 grams of solid white gold was used for the label and the diamond has 19 carats. Also in white gold was made the label on which was engraved the name of the wealthy buyer of the bottle. The work has been completely handmade, as for the iconic brand Goût de Diamants craftsmanship reigns supreme.
Goût de Diamants, Taste of Diamonds was first presented in 2013 by British businessman Shammi Shine, founder of Prodiguer Brands.
